I loved embossing and inking the punched circles. I love that look. I tore and inked some vanilla c/s.....it's been a long time since I did any tearing. The polka dot paper is from my scrap box. It's a retired Christmas SU pack.
**Something new** I colored my pearls with a copic marker to make it go better with the card. I used #E11. This is a first, and I loved it!...can't wait to try it with some, more vibrant color.
